Restorative Yoga and Massage Workshop with Marilyn Bird, RYT

 

 

Sunday, February 19th;  4:00 – 5:30 pm

 

$25 in advance; $30 at door

 

Space is limited; preregistration is recommended

Appropriate for all fitness levels, no previous yoga experience required.

 

This workshop combines a soft, restorative Yoga practice accompanied by massage to ease muscle aches and tension and create relaxation.

 

Relaxing postures are fully supported with bolsters and other props and held for several minutes to invite release and enhance breathing awareness.

 

Please bring at least 2 firm bed pillows or sofa cushions and a blanket.

Prenatal Yoga with Lori Krajenke, RYT

 

Six week Prenatal Yoga Series, advance registration required

Next session Saturday February  25th – 1:15 – 2:30 pm. 

$90 for the six week session.

 

Take this opportunity to cultivate a greater awareness of your body as it grows your baby and prepares for birth!!

 

We will incorporate gentle yoga poses, breath work and meditation to increase flexibility, generate calmness and confidence in what our bodies are created to do, birth our babies!

 

When practiced mindfully, yoga increases flexibility, strength, circulation and balance. Pregnancy is a physical experience – and yoga allows Mom to adapt more gracefully to these changes and to feel a sense of integration and appreciation for her body. Many women find that regular yoga practice helps to reduce swelling, back & leg pain, and insomnia.

 

Yoga can also help to deepen the bond between Mom and Baby by giving time each work for Mom to focus solely on her baby, without any outside distractions.  We will also build community with other expecting moms and work through our fears about labor and birth.  Reducing these common stressors will reduce the stress to your baby through your pregnancy and delivery.

 

No previous yoga experience necessary and is appropriate for all fitness levels.
